This position serves as a flexible Program Specialist/Aid Subs floater within our regional network. You will be based at a primary site but may be requested to work across various locations in the area to support our mission. The role is designed for individuals who thrive in dynamic environments, adapting to different club cultures while maintaining high standards of program delivery.
You will plan, implement, and supervise activities that promote the safety of members, the quality of our programs, and the overall appearance of the Club. As a key representative of our organization, you will act as a mentor and role model, inspiring youth, adults, and volunteers through creative engagement and positive guidance.
Your day will involve facilitating engaging programs and activities tailored to youth development needs. You will design colorful displays and bulletin boards to promote program areas and assist in executing national projects and exhibits. A significant part of your role involves building and cultivating positive relationships with youth, parents, local community leaders, schools, and churches.
You will be responsible for maintaining accurate records of participants, schedules, attendance, and program results. While the core schedule is Monday through Friday between 2:00 PM and 6:30 PM (up to 4 hours a day), summer hours may vary. Occasional weekend and evening work may be required to support fundraising events and activities in after-school and recreational settings, both indoors and outdoors.
